Body found in Oklahoma City is missing Blanchard woman, Oklahoma City police say
Jaymie Adams, 25, of Blanchard, was reported missing by her husband Dec. 10. Bikers using the dirt track at SW 59 and Douglas called police about 1 p.m. Saturday after finding a woman's body. Oklahoma City police Capt. Lisa Camacho said the body was identified as Jaymie Adams.

kevinpate
01-09-2012, 09:31 AM
Why is lake Stanley Draper the dumping ground for so many murderers? It's as if it is the published address when someone wants to drop off a body.

Ms. Adams' body was found north of Draper a ways, near a dirt bike track, not at Draper.

However, Draper has had numerous bodies left there in years past. Not nearly as many in recent years. The territory there has changed a lot is the most probable reason.

Years back, there were little to no paved roads except the ring around the lake. Today there are many paved routes to inlets, even jazzed up playgrounds and camping areas. More traffic would impede some risky behaviors like body dumping. Also, for a while now, the lake level has been incredibly low due to dam work or some other work. Seems I recall a thread here about dam work last summer. Many areas at Draper where one might have previously slipped a body into brush at the water's edge do not exist, as the water's edge is 100 yards plus further away. Finally, even where the roads are not paved, the quality of the dirt road surface has vastly improved from say 15-20 years ago. There are places today I could comfortably take a Sunday drive in a Lincoln now that I wouldn't have considered attempting in a passenger vehicle during the mid-late 90's and even later.
